Mike Wright-Chapman Bio
2008 Men's Retreat Speaker |
|
Mike has served in six small, medium and large churches in youth and Christian Education ministries since 1981. He served as Minister to Youth at First United Methodist Church, Wichita Falls from 1987 to 1990. This is his second appointment on a Conference staff. He served the Central Texas Conference as Director of Youth and Young Adult Ministries from 1996-1999. Mike is certified by The United Methodist Church in Christian Education (1990) and Youth Ministry (1992, the first year it was available). He received Foundational Training for Judicatory Leaders in the Prevention of Clergy Sexual Abuse at FaithTrust Institute (formerly The Center for the Prevention of Sexual and Domestic Violence), Seattle, Washington in 1996. A graduate of Crowley High School, Mike earned a Bachelor of Arts in Humanities-Religion from Texas Wesleyan University, Fort Worth, in 1984 and a Master of Arts in Christian Education from Scarritt Graduate School, Nashville, Tennessee in 1987. He was consecrated as a Diaconal Minister by Bishop John W. Russell in 1988 at First United Methodist Church, Fort Worth. He was ordained a Deacon in 1997 by Bishop Joe A. Wilson at Austin Avenue United Methodist Church in Waco, Texas. Mike is married to Kathy Wright-Chapman, Director of Academic Services at Education Service Center, Region XI in Fort Worth. They have one son, Matt, who is 14. If you have questions or comments, please contact Troy Sims at 940-766-4231 x229. |
